What is The Hollywood Smile Procedure?

Most patients cannot achieve Hollywood Smile in just one session; in fact, there is no set procedure that dental professionals follow for all patients. In this way, instead of adopting a uniform approach, the Hollywood Smile procedure is designed for each patient individually. There are various possible treatments that you could get for a Hollywood smile. These are the most common procedures in dental clinics.

 

Teeth Whitening

White teeth are probably the first thing that comes to mind when we think of the Hollywood smile. No wonder that teeth whitening is one of the most popular procedure in dental clinics.

 

Dental Implants

If you have missing teeth that prevent you from smiling like a Hollywood star, you might need more advanced solutions. Dental implants are one of the most functional and aesthetic options for replacing your missing teeth. You can have stronger and more beautiful teeth at the end of the procedure. In addition, the dental bridge procedure is also widely applied in clinics. The dental bridge is a convenient way to bridge the 1-2 tooth gap between two healthy teeth.

 

 

Crowns

Crowns are used for dental restoration by covering them with a cap. It is a convenient and efficient way, especially if you prefer high-quality products and get proper service. There are different types of crowns. You can find porcelain, Zirconia, metal, or porcelain fused metal crowns

 

Orthodontic Treatment

To get a perfect Hollywood Smile, you need to have ideal teeth alignment. Depending on your case, your dentist may prescribe retainers, braces to give your teeth proper alignment and bite correction.  Orthodontic treatments generally take longer to see effects. Also, if you need orthodontic treatment, you should do it before other short-term treatments.

What Are The Cases Who May Need This Procedure:

-Correction of permanent tooth discoloration due to enamel defects that cannot be removed by whitening procedures

-Restoration of worn or broken teeth

-Teeth with large cosmetic fillings, which have lost color and become different from the color of adjacent teeth.

- Broken teeth.

-Correction of misalignment of teeth that suffer from deviation or are not equal in size and length and their shape is inappropriate with the rest of the teeth.

-Filling of spaces between teeth

Types of Fixed Hollywood Smile:

A fixed Hollywood smile can be divided according to the materials in its composition for:

Composite Resin Veneers: This type of Hollywood veneers, is characterized by being the cheapest and easiest in terms of being able to make adjustments to it in case of damage, but on the other hand, dental veneers in resin are considered the weakest among all other materials. Its lifespan is shorter compared to ceramic or porcelain types of veneers.

Porcelain Veneers: Porcelain veneers are considered the best, in terms of strength, hardness and chew factors, so they are the best compared to composite resin veneers, and they are very similar in shape and feel. appearance of the real tooth, and they are also highly resistant to scratching and pressure factors.

The steps of the process (Hollywood smile):

Step 1 - Consultation and Smile Assessment

During your consultation and smile evaluation, our cosmetic dentists will examine your teeth to establish if porcelain veneers are the right choice for you and explain the full extent of the makeover procedure.

In this consultation, you will discuss the preferred shape, length, width and color of your new teeth. This is an opportunity for patients to establish desired outcomes and expectations in advance.

Our dentist will take impressions and photographs of the patient's mouth, which will be used to develop temporary veneers and preview the digital smile design of your new Hollywood makeover for the second appointment.

This is done to ensure that our new patients are 100% satisfied with their new smile before committing.

Step 2 - Preview and Apply the Digital Smile

  We create a set of temporary veneers based on the initial consultation requirements, which are ready to be applied if the patient goes ahead with this design. The preview of the digital smile design is also shown to the patient.

Our cosmetic dentists will begin working on the patient's teeth, removing a very thin layer (half a millimeter) of tooth enamel to make room for temporary veneers. Depending on the patient, local anesthesia may be used.

Once the removal process is complete, a new mold will be taken of your teeth and sent to our in-house lab where permanent porcelain veneers are designed and created.

Step 3 - Permanent Placement

On the third and final visit, your beautiful custom porcelain veneers are installed.

Our cosmetic dentist will place the veneers on your teeth for evaluation, and they may need to be cut or modified to ensure the perfect fit.

Once your veneers fit snugly, your teeth will be cleaned and polished and will have the etching to adhere to the cement that will permanently bond your veneers in place.

A high quality dental cement is applied to each veneer and then placed on your teeth. Once in position, our cosmetic dentist will use a special light on each veneer to harden the dental cement.

Once all of your veneers are installed, the excess dental cement will be removed, your bite assessed and you now have your very own Hollywood smile!

Step 4 - Follow-up

A few weeks after your procedure, a follow-up appointment is needed to make sure everything is perfect. We will check the patient's mouth, gums and porcelain veneers to see how everything is placed and responding to each other. Hopefully, you've officially had your "Hollywood" makeover

Instructions after the procedure (Hollywood smile)

-Clean the teeth 3 times a day to prevent cavities below the cortex, because removing dandruff and treating cavities below is very expensive.

-Use mouthwash once before bed and in the morning to avoid unpleasant odors.

- Quit smoking completely.

-Stop consuming foods and beverages with dyes such as tea, coffee, beets, etc.

-Avoid biting solid foods to prevent shell rupture.

-Avoid violent sports which can cause the veneers to break, such as boxing, football, etc.

Although dental veneers are delicate, they can last up to 20 years if proper care and better oral hygiene are provided.
